Ambienta has been awarded “2018 ESG Best Practices Honours” by SWEN Capital Partners

by Ambienta

Milan, 02 July 2018 – Ambienta, the largest private equity fund focused on sustainability, has been awarded the 2018 ESG Best Practices Honours in the “Private Equity Mid & Large Cap” category, by SWEN Capital Partners (“SWEN CP”), a leading European investment management company specializing in responsible investing in private markets.

The event, which took place in Paris on 27 June, gathered 420 market players primarily from the private equity, debt and infrastructure industries with the aim of showcasing outstanding ESG practices amongst over 200 European management companies, both within SWEN CP’s portfolio and across its potential investment universe.

The winners were selected from management companies that participated in SWEN CP’s annual ESG survey, using a methodology which analyses and measures how extra‐financial criteria are integrated and implemented into the GPs’ investment process, as well as at the underlying company level.

The winners were chosen by an independent jury of 11 highly qualified individuals, representing institutional investors and international organisations such as the UN Principles for Responsible Investment and the Organisation for Economic Co‐operation and Development. Previous winners of the “Private Equity Mid & Large Cap” category include PAI Partners, Eurazeo and Ardian.

Since it was founded, Ambienta has introduced various initiatives to create an all‐encompassing approach to sustainability. It has devised the “Environmental Impact Analysis” as a proprietary methodology to assess portfolio companies’ impact both in terms of resource efficiency and pollution control, measuring sustainability granularly against 11 key metrics. Similarly, the “ESG in Action” programme has a holistic approach to the integration of the UN’s six Principles for Responsible Investment at both GP and portfolio company level. In addition, the firm has introduced a dedicated “ESG Drive” parameter into its investment team’s performance review, reflecting its ambition to promote accountability across the firm.
